The wiggins year everyone was hyping up… two can’t miss prospects in wiggins and Parker. Best one ended up being embiid. Lavine went 13th. Julius Randle 7th. Aaron Gordon 4th and Marcus smart 6th both just good starter/role players but not stars.
The draft is hard. Regardless of where we pick in the top 10, it’s up to the scouting department to figure it out. What is cooper flaggs best case comp?
